vue2配置跨域后请求的是本机

这个我来说明一下,因为我们公司的后端设置解决了跨域问题,所以我有很久没有看相关的内容了,然后昨天请求了需要跨域的接口,请求半天一直不对,浏览器显示的是本机地址,我以为是自己配置错了,后面发现

其实配置了跨域之后,浏览器中看的请求地址就是自己的本机地址,并且是vue2项目的地址,如果后端没有返回,那是后端接口的问题

比如现在我在本地启动了一个端口是 2555 的接口,然后配置跨域

配置代码:

组件代码:

复制代码
<template>
  <div>
    <el-button @click="sendRequest">点我发送请求</el-button>
  </div>
</template>

<script>
import axios from 'axios'
export default {
  name: '',
  methods: {
    sendRequest() {
      axios.get('/api/users/test').then((res) => {
        console.log(res, 'res')
        this.$message.success(res.data)
      })
    },
  },
}
</script>

<style lang="" scoped></style>

点击发送请求之后,浏览器网络页面显示的是vue2的项目地址,但是实际请求已经发送给配置代理的目标地址了:

相关推荐
听风说图几秒前
从 JavaScript 到 WGSL:用渐变渲染理解 GPU 编程思维
前端
float_六七1 分钟前
CSS行内盒子:30字掌握核心特性
前端·css
倔强的钧仔2 分钟前
拒绝废话!前端开发中最常用的 10 个 ES6 特性(附极简代码)
前端·javascript·面试
喔烨鸭4 分钟前
vue3中使用原生表格展示数据
前端·javascript·vue.js
Hacker_seagull4 分钟前
Java 8安装详细教程
java·开发语言
小白学大数据4 分钟前
随机间隔在 Python 爬虫中的应用实践
开发语言·c++·爬虫·python
软件开发技术深度爱好者7 分钟前
JavaScript的p5.js库坐标系图解
开发语言·前端·javascript
松涛和鸣8 分钟前
54、DS18B20单线数字温度采集
linux·服务器·c语言·开发语言·数据库
Gofarlic_OMS14 分钟前
MATLAB许可证闲置自动检测与智能提醒
java·大数据·运维·开发语言·人工智能·算法·matlab
yaoxin52112315 分钟前
293. Java Stream API - 从 HTTP 源创建 Stream
java·开发语言·http